モバイル決済技術の市場規模と予測

モバイル決済技術の市場規模は、2024年に7,427億2,000万米ドルと評価され、2026~2032年にかけて58.85%のCAGRで成長し、2032年には22兆7,124億1,000万米ドルに達すると予測されます。

モバイル決済技術は、小売、eコマース、輸送、さらにはピアツーピア決済など幅広い用途があり、ユーザーは複数の場所で楽に取引を行うことができます。

モバイル決済技術の将来は有望で、セキュリティ機能の進化、ブロックチェーンや人工知能などの新技術との統合、発展途上地域での採用拡大などが期待され、これらすべてが世界中のユーザーの利便性とアクセシビリティを向上させると考えられます。

モバイル決済技術の世界市場力学

世界のモバイル決済技術市場を形成している主要市場力学は以下の通りです。

主要促進要因

スマートフォン普及率の増加:スマートフォンの世界の普及は、モバイル決済技術市場の主要促進要因です。2021年までに38億人以上のスマートフォンユーザーが見込まれるモバイル決済アプリは、消費者がいつでもどこからでも簡単に買い物を行えるようにします。この動向は今後も続き、モバイル決済システムの利用が加速すると予測されています。2024年4月、Appleは、新興市場におけるiPhoneの販売台数が前年比22%増となり、モバイル決済機能が普及の主要因となったと発表しました。

非接触型決済への嗜好の高まり:COVID-19の流行に後押しされた非接触型決済ソリューションへの需要の高まりは、モバイル決済技術セグメントを大きく強化しました。消費者は取引中の物理的接触を避けるため、非接触型決済の手軽さと安全性を好むようになっています。このような消費者行動の動向は、加盟店がモバイル決済ソリューションを利用して顧客の要望を満たすことを後押ししています。

セキュリティ技術の進歩:生体認証(指紋認証や顔認証)やトークン化など、セキュリティ対策の継続的な改善により、モバイル決済システムに対する顧客の信頼が高まっています。セキュリティへの懸念が依然として導入の障壁となっている中、こうした進歩はリスクを限定し、機密性の高い決済情報を保護するのに役立ち、より多くの人々にモバイル決済技術の利用を促しています。2024年3月、Visaは、同社のネットワーク上のモバイル決済取引の60%で生体認証方法(指紋、顔認証)が使用され、前年の45%から増加したと発表しました。

政府の取り組みと規制:多くの政府は、金融包摂を促進し、現金取引への依存を最小限に抑えるため、デジタル決済の代替手段を支援しています。デジタル決済プラットフォームへの補助金、モバイル決済を受け入れる加盟店への優遇措置、安全な決済エコシステムを奨励する規則などの取り組みがモバイル決済技術市場を前進させ、企業や消費者にこうしたソリューションの利用を促しています。米国連邦準備制度理事会(FRB)は2024年4月、2025年に開始予定の迅速な決済サービス「Fed Now」の開発を発表し、モバイル決済の利用が増加すると予測しました。

主要課題

セキュリティへの懸念:セキュリティ技術の進歩にもかかわらず、モバイル決済セグメントはデータ漏洩や詐欺行為に悩まされ続けています。利用者は金融情報や個人情報のセキュリティに懸念を抱いており、それがモバイル決済ソリューションの利用を妨げている可能性があります。強固なセキュリティ対策を確保し、消費者の信頼を勝ち取ることは、このセグメントの組織にとって依然として大きな難題です。

標準化の欠如:モバイル決済のエコシステムには統一規格がないため、異なる決済プラットフォームやデバイス間の相互運用性に課題があります。技術、プロトコル、ユーザーインターフェースが異なると、消費者の混乱を招き、摩擦のない取引の妨げとなります。産業全体の標準を確立することは、相互運用性を高め、全体的なユーザーエクスペリエンスを向上させる上で極めて重要です。

インフラの限界:多くの場所、特に発展途上国では、不十分な技術インフラがモバイル決済システムの導入の妨げとなっています。インターネットへのアクセスの悪さ、スマートフォンの普及率の低さ、支える決済インフラの不足はすべて、モバイル決済の一般的な受容性と有効性を阻害する要因となります。

規制上の課題:モバイル決済ビジネスには複雑な規制が適用され、その内容は地域によって大きく異なります。データ保護、マネーロンダリング防止、決済処理に関する異なる基準への準拠は、世界に事業を展開する企業にとって困難な場合があります。こうした規制のハードルを乗り越えるには多大なリソースが必要であり、市場参入のスピードや成長戦略に影響を及ぼす可能性があります。

主要動向

デジタルウォレットの普及:Apple Pay、Googleペイ、Samsungペイなどのデジタルウォレットを利用する消費者が増えています。これらのウォレットを使えば、ユーザーは様々な決済方法を一カ所にまとめて保存できるため、店舗でもオンラインでも迅速な買い物が可能になります。eコマースの台頭と、摩擦のないチェックアウト体験への需要が、デジタルウォレットへの追い風となっています。

バイオメトリクス認証の統合:指紋スキャンや顔認証などのバイオメトリクス認証方式は、モバイル決済システムでますます利用されるようになっています。この動向は、決済アプリへの迅速かつ安全なアクセスを可能にすることで、セキュリティを高め、ユーザー体験を向上させています。消費者が取引の安全性を重視する中、生体認証の統合は増加すると予測されます。

非接触型決済の拡大:特にCOVID-19の大流行以降、非接触型決済技術の移行が進んでいます。消費者は、購入時に物理的な接触を避けるために、非接触カードやスマートフォン決済を利用するようになっています。この傾向は加盟店に非接触型決済技術の利用を促し、モバイル決済ソリューションの全体的な拡大に寄与しています。

決済における暗号通貨の利用の増加:デジタル通貨を受け入れるプラットフォームや小売業者の数が増加しているため、決済方法としての暗号通貨の受け入れが拡大しています。ブロックチェーン技術の進歩と安定したコインの生成により、消費者は暗号通貨を通常の取引に利用できるようになりました。この開発はモバイル決済のエコシステムを変革し、ユーザーに既存通貨に代わる選択肢を提供することになると考えられます。

Mobile Payment Technology Market Size And Forecast

Mobile Payment Technology Market size was valued at USD 742.72 Billion in 2024 and is projected to reach USD 22712.41 Billion by 2032, growing at a CAGR of 58.85% from 2026 to 2032. goods and services swiftly and securely through a variety of payment methods such as near-field communication (NFC), mobile wallets, and online banking apps.

Mobile payment technology has a wide range of applications, including retail, e-commerce, transportation, and even peer-to-peer payments, allowing users to make transactions effortlessly across several locations.

The future of mobile payment technology looks promising, with expected advancements in security features, integration with emerging technologies such as blockchain and artificial intelligence, and increased adoption in developing regions, all of which will improve convenience and accessibility for users worldwide.

Global Mobile Payment Technology Market Dynamics

The key market dynamics that are shaping the global mobile payment technology market include:

Key Drivers:

Increasing Smartphone Penetration: The global use of smartphones is a major driver of the mobile payment technology market. With over 3.8 billion smartphone users by 2021, mobile payment apps make it easy for consumers to perform purchases at any time and from any location. This trend is projected to continue, accelerating the use of mobile payment systems. In April 2024, Apple stated that iPhone sales in emerging markets increased by 22% year on year, with mobile payment functionality being a key driver of adoption.

Growing Preference for Contactless Payments: The increase in demand for contactless payment solutions, aided by the COVID-19 epidemic, has greatly strengthened the mobile payment technology sector. Consumers are increasingly preferring the ease and security of contactless payments to avoid physical contact during transactions. This trend in consumer behavior encourages merchants to use mobile payment solutions to satisfy client desires.

Advancements in Security Technologies: Continuous improvements in security measures, such as biometric authentication (fingerprint and facial recognition) and tokenization, are increasing customer trust in mobile payment systems. As security concerns remain a barrier to adoption, these advancements help limit risks and protect sensitive payment information, encouraging more people to use mobile payment technology. In March 2024, Visa announced that biometric authentication methods (fingerprint, facial recognition) were used in 60% of mobile payment transactions on its network, up from 45% the year before.

Government Initiatives and Regulations: Many governments are supporting digital payment alternatives to increase financial inclusion and minimize reliance on cash transactions. Initiatives like as subsidies for digital payment platforms, incentives for merchants to accept mobile payments, and rules that encourage secure payment ecosystems are propelling the mobile payment technology market forward, pushing businesses and consumers to use these solutions. The United States Federal Reserve announced in April 2024 the development of Fed Now, a quick payment service slated to start in 2025 and projected to increase mobile payment use.

Key Challenges:

Security Concerns: Despite advances in security technologies, the mobile payment sector continues to be plagued by data leaks and fraudulent activity. Users are concerned about the security of their financial and personal information, which may prevent them from using mobile payment solutions. Ensuring strong security measures and winning consumer trust are still major difficulties for organizations in this field.

Lack of Standardization: The mobile payment ecosystem lacks uniform standards, which causes interoperability challenges between different payment platforms and devices. Different technologies, protocols, and user interfaces can cause consumer confusion and impede frictionless transactions. Establishing industry-wide standards is critical for increasing interoperability and improving the overall user experience.

Infrastructure Limitations: In many places, particularly in developing countries, insufficient technology infrastructure can hinder the adoption of mobile payment systems. Poor internet access, low smartphone adoption, and a lack of supporting payment infrastructure can all impede mobile payments' general acceptability and effectiveness.

Regulatory Challenges: The mobile payment business is governed by a complicated set of regulations that can vary greatly by area. Compliance with differing standards on data protection, anti-money laundering, and payment processing can be difficult for organizations operating globally. Navigating these regulatory hurdles demands significant resources and might have an impact on the speed of market entry and growth strategy.

Key Trends:

Increasing Adoption of Digital Wallets: Consumers are increasingly turning to digital wallets like Apple Pay, Google Pay, and Samsung Pay as they seek easy and secure payment solutions. These wallets let users to store various payment methods in one location, allowing for rapid purchases both in-store and online. The rise of e-commerce and the demand for frictionless checkout experiences fuel the push toward digital wallets.

Integration of Biometric Authentication: Biometric identification methods, such as fingerprint scanning and facial recognition, are increasingly being used in mobile payment systems. This trend increases security and improves user experience by allowing for quick and secure access to payment apps. As consumer's value safety in their transactions, biometric integration is projected to increase.

Expansion of Contactless Payments: The transition of contactless payment technologies has increased, especially since the COVID-19 pandemic. Consumers are increasingly using contactless cards and smartphone payments to avoid physical contact during purchases. This tendency encourages merchants to use contactless payment technology, which contributes to the overall expansion of mobile payment solutions.

Increasing Use of Cryptocurrency for Payment: The acceptance of cryptocurrencies as a payment method is growing, due to a rising number of platforms and retailers who accept digital currencies. Consumers can now utilize cryptocurrencies for regular transactions thanks to advancements in blockchain technology and the creation of stable coins. This development is likely to transform the mobile payment ecosystem, providing users with alternatives to established currencies.

Asia Pacific:

The Asia Pacific area is experiencing tremendous expansion in the mobile payment technology market, owing to rising smartphone adoption and a thriving digital economy. In September 2023, Alibaba's Ant Group said that it would expand its mobile payment services in Southeast Asia, reflecting the region's potential for mobile commerce.

For instance, in August 2023, the Reserve Bank of India launched the "Digital Payments Utsav" campaign to encourage people and companies to switch to digital payment systems. Furthermore, in July 2023 poll performed by the Asia-Pacific Economic Cooperation (APEC) revealed that about 75% of consumers in the area have used mobile payment apps in the previous year, indicating that customers are becoming more comfortable and trusting of these technologies.

Global Mobile Payment Technology Market: Segmentation Analysis

The Global Mobile Payment Technology Market is segmented on the basis of Payment Type, Transaction Mode, Purchase Type, Application, and Geography.

Mobile Payment Technology Market, By Payment Type

  • Proximity
  • Remote

Based on Payment Type, the Global Mobile Payment Technology Market is segmented into Proximity, and Remote. The proximity payment category is currently prominent, as it includes popular methods like as NFC (Near Field Communication) and QR code payments, which are commonly used in retail situations. The remote payment segment is the fastest-growing, driven by rising demand for e-commerce and digital transactions, especially in the aftermath of the COVID-19 pandemic, as customers seek simple and flexible payment solutions for online purchases.

Mobile Payment Technology Market, By Transaction Mode

  • Mobile Web Payments
  • Near-Field Communication
  • SMS/Direct Carrier Billing

Based on Transaction Mode, the Global Mobile Payment Technology Market is segmented into Mobile Web Payments, Near-Field Communication, and SMS/Direct Carrier Billing. The Near-Field Communication (NFC) segment is currently prominent because it allows for easy and secure transactions in retail contexts via tap-to-pay. Meanwhile, Mobile Web Payments is the fastest-growing area, driven by the rise of e-commerce and mobile shopping, as consumers prefer to make purchases directly through mobile websites and apps.

Mobile Payment Technology Market, By Purchase Type

  • Airtime Transfer and Top-Ups
  • Money Transfers and Bill Payments
  • Merchandise and Coupons
  • Travel and Ticketing

Based on Purchase Type, the Global Mobile Payment Technology Market is segmented into Airtime Transfer and Top-Ups, Money Transfers and Bill Payments, Merchandise and Coupons, Travel and Ticketing. The Money Transfers and Bill Payments sector is now prominent because it includes a wide range of important financial operations that customers often conduct. The Travel and Ticketing area is the fastest-growing, driven by rising demand for simple payment options in the travel industry, especially as travel resumes and digital ticketing becomes more common.

Mobile Payment Technology Market, By Application

  • Media & Entertainment
  • Energy & Utilities
  • Healthcare
  • Retail
  • Hospitality & Transportation

Based on Application, the Global Mobile Payment Technology Market is segmented into Media & Entertainment, Energy & Utilities, Healthcare, Retail, and Hospitality & Transportation. The retail market is currently dominant, due to the growing adoption of mobile payment solutions for both in-store and online buying experiences. The Hospitality & Transportation area is the fastest-growing, owing to rising consumer demand for frictionless payment experiences when booking services and traveling, notably via applications and digital channels.

Mobile Payment Technology Market, By Geography

  • North America
  • Europe
  • Asia Pacific
  • Rest of the World

Based on the Geography, the Global Mobile Payment Technology Market are classified into North America, Europe, Asia Pacific, Rest of the World. North America is currently the dominant region, due to sophisticated technology infrastructure and widespread consumer use of mobile payment options. The Asia Pacific area is the fastest growing, owing to a quickly increasing digital economy, greater smartphone penetration, and rising consumer preference for mobile payments in countries such as China and India.

  • Global Mobile Payment Technology Market: Recent Developments
  • In July 2023, Apple announced an update to its Apple Pay service that included support for new cryptocurrencies. This move corresponds with rising consumer interest in digital currencies, allowing users to perform transactions using multiple cryptocurrencies directly through Apple Wallet.
  • In August 2023, Samsung Pay has teamed with various banks in the United States to develop a loyalty rewards program for its users. Customers can earn points for each mobile payment transaction, which promotes consumer engagement and encourages the adoption of mobile payments.
  • In August 2023, Visa increased its partnership with fintech startups to improve mobile payment security using blockchain technology. This collaboration seeks to use decentralized systems to improve the transparency and security of mobile transactions, thereby addressing growing concerns about fraud in digital payments.
